One might think that by the year 2011, we wouldn't be spending so much time at our desks.
Even though we have iPads and mobile phones to liberate us from the constant sitting, many Americans still suffer from repetitive stress injuries (RSIs for short). RSIs are any kind of constant ache or pain that result from tasks like mashing keys for 8 hours a day or constantly texting.
Ironically the more mobile devices we use, the more we are at risk for repetitive stress injuries. Sitting in uniform position, causes strain to the neck, hands, and lower back. Thumbs aren’t designed for typing, this can lead to text message tendonitis, but we do it anyway, and suffer the consequences. So what are we doing to combat these technologically induced problems?
